
Ever dreamed of being in a PlayStation game? Sony is now offering a program called The Playerbase that lets them scan you and include your digital likeness in a PS5 game!
One lucky Gran Turismo 7 fan will have their image featured in the game as a character portrait for a limited time! The winner will also get to create a car decal that will be permanently available in the game. To enter, you’ll need to apply through the provided link, and the winner will be flown to a Los Angeles studio for a scan and to design their decal.

PlayStation’s new ‘Playerbase’ program is a thank you to its community, the players who have made PlayStation what it is today,” explained Isabelle Tomatis, Vice President of Global Marketing. “We’re excited to connect with fans and offer them a fresh way to experience the PlayStation universe.”
For years, sports games like NBA 2K and WWE 2K have let you create a digital version of yourself using smartphone apps. But The Playerbase is taking a more professional approach, aiming to realistically place your likeness into a major game developed and published directly by the game company.
